Mink Ventures Corporation Completes Phase Two Drilling at Warren Project, Timmins

TORONTO, July 14,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Mink Ventures Corporation (TSXV:MINK) (“Mink” or the “Company“) today announced it has completed two drill holes (477 meters) to drill test two VTEM Maxwell Plate anomalies outlined at its Warren property for potential nickel (Ni), copper (Cu), cobalt (Co) mineralization. Core logging has just been completed and sampling of mineralized intervals is well underway. Results from assays will be reported upon receipt of results, which are anticipated towards the end of August.

Following this, the Company plans to initiate a drill program at its Montcalm Ni Cu Co Project. This is expected to begin in late August or early September, subject to ground conditions for access at that time.

In mid-December, preparation of the winter access road into the northern portion of the Warren property will begin in anticipation of the Phase 3 drilling program, which will drill test three, new VTEM targets proximal to historical drill hole ML-1 which returned 0.84% Cu over 4.3 meters (Figures 2 & 3).

WARREN PROPERTY GEOLOGY:

Mink’s Warren Project is hosted within the Kamiskotia Gabbro Complex (KGC) and is thought to be broadly equivalent to the Montcalm Gabbro Complex (MGC) but separated by a granitic arch. The MGC hosts the former Montcalm Mine which produced approximately 3.93 million tonnes grading 1.25% Ni, 0.67% Cu and 0.05% Co (OGS, Atkinson, B., 2010).

Gabbro complexes such as MGC and KGC are known to be prospective for magmatic nickel copper sulphide deposition as demonstrated by the Montcalm Mine located within the MGC. The Warren property complements Mink’s Montcalm property due to the distinctly similar prospective geological environments found in the MGC and the KGC, as well as the presence of significant Cu Ni zones on the Warren Property.

The Warren Property also hosts a felsic volcanic package along the western edge of the KGC with some significant copper mineralization. This volcanic package represents a second target area of interest with potential to host copper zinc volcanogenic massive sulphide (VMS) deposits.
